The Minnesota Diabetes Plan 2010 (the Plan)
is the second statewide 10-year strategic plan for diabetes in the
state of Minnesota. The purpose of the Plan is to communicate
the vision of creating a healthier future for all people in Minnesota
and provide a roadmap for achieving that vision. The goals and recommendations
of the Plan show our community how to work together more
effectively to reduce the burden of diabetes in Minnesota.
Diabetes Plan CENTRAL (Collaborative Exchange Network To Raise
Awareness & Learning) is a web tool designed to serve as an
interactive communication hub for the diabetes community to facilitate
accomplishing the goals of the Plan.
